WebFirst, you will die of dehydration much faster than you will starve. Without water, most people can only survive 1-3 days if it’s hot and not more than about 6 days at best. For most people, it takes 35-40 days before the really serious symptoms of starvation set in. After 60-70 days without food, most people will die. Dehydration WebDehydration is a normal process during the last days of life that act as a natural anaesthetic at the end of life. This anaesthetic effect can be explained in the following different ways: Fewer bouts of vomiting due to reduced gastrointestinal fluid. Decreased oedema and swelling. Decreased urine (CRHCF,2015).
